Q: Is 103,012,212 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 103,012,212 is a composite number.

Why is 103,012,212 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 103,012,212 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 8,584,351 17,168,702 25,753,053 34,337,404 51,506,106 and 103,012,212, with no remainder.

Since 103,012,212 cannot be divided by just 1 and 103,012,212, it is a composite number.
